what is scada means
SCADA (Supervisory Control and Data Acquisition) is a type of software and hardware system used in industrial control systems to monitor and control various industrial processes such as manufacturing, energy generation, water treatment, and transportation systems. The purpose of SCADA systems is to provide real-time data about the state of these processes, allowing operators to make informed decisions and take appropriate actions when necessary.
SCADA systems consist of three main components: the supervisory system, the remote terminal units (RTUs) or programmable logic controllers (PLCs), and the communication network that connects them.
The supervisory system is the main user interface for the SCADA system, and it typically consists of a computer or a network of computers running specialized software that allows operators to monitor and control the processes being monitored. The software displays real-time data, such as temperature, pressure, flow rates, and other relevant process variables, in the form of graphs, charts, and other visual representations. The software may also provide tools for operators to configure alarms and notifications, set up automatic responses to certain events, and generate reports.
The remote terminal units (RTUs) or programmable logic controllers (PLCs) are the devices that are responsible for collecting data from the various sensors and other input devices that are installed in the industrial process being monitored. These devices are usually located in the field, close to the sensors and other equipment, and they communicate with the supervisory system via a communication network.
The communication network is the backbone of the SCADA system, connecting the supervisory system and the RTUs or PLCs. This network can be a wired or wireless network, and it can use various communication protocols such as Modbus, DNP3, or OPC. The communication network must be reliable and secure to ensure that the data being transmitted is accurate and protected from unauthorized access.
In summary, SCADA systems are used to monitor and control industrial processes by providing real-time data about the state of these processes. The systems consist of a supervisory system, RTUs or PLCs, and a communication network that connects them. SCADA systems are essential in modern industrial operations, as they help operators to optimize their processes, reduce downtime, and improve safety and efficiency.
